      <description>&lt;P&gt;Thanks for the reply.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;I found the issue, the Kerberos setup was fine the only thing missing was, providing the Kerberos Principal and Keytab path to the&amp;nbsp;&lt;STRONG&gt;IMPALA_CATALOG_ARGS.&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;In the CDH documentation (&amp;nbsp;&lt;A href="https://docs.cloudera.com/documentation/enterprise/5-14-x/topics/impala_kerberos.html" target="_self"&gt;CDH Impala Kerberos&lt;/A&gt;&amp;nbsp; Point 7)&lt;/P&gt;&lt;LI-CODE lang="markup"&gt;7. Add Kerberos options to the Impala defaults file, /etc/default/impala. Add the options for both the impalad and statestored daemons, using the IMPALA_SERVER_ARGS and IMPALA_STATE_STORE_ARGS variables&lt;/LI-CODE&gt;&lt;P&gt;that I followed they have only mentioned to update&amp;nbsp;&lt;STRONG&gt;IMPALA_STATE_STORE_ARGS&lt;/STRONG&gt; and&amp;nbsp;&lt;STRONG&gt;IMPALA_SERVER_ARGS,&amp;nbsp;&lt;/STRONG&gt; that's why catalog server was not authenticating with Kerberos. After adding the the Kerberos Principal and keytab path I was able to start the without any issues.&lt;/P&gt;</description>
